Path: utzoo!mnetor!uunet!husc6!mit-eddie!uw-beaver!tektronix!oresoft!randy From: randy@oresoft.UUCP (Randy Bush) Newsgroups: comp.dcom.modems Subject: Re: Trailblazer vs. USR 9600 HST Message-ID: <104@oresoft.UUCP> Date: 31 Dec 87 19:46:10 GMT Reply-To: randy@oresoft.UUCP (Randy Bush) Distribution: na Organization: Oregon Software, Portland OR Lines: 13 Summary: more FIdoNetters went for 9600 than one would think A count of the number of 9600 baud nodes in the current FidoNet nodelist shows 249 nodes, not counting possible duplicate listings (hosts, hubs, ...). That's over ten percent of the nodes. The current nodelist format does not provide for a reliable count of how many are from what vendor. This too shall pass. Again, it's not that the current TB ROM upgrade did not meet the FidoNetters' needs. It's that they are very worried that the next ones (or the one after) won't. -- randy%oresoft.uucp@tektronix.tek.com FidoNet:1:105/6.6 randy%oresoft.uucp%tektronix.tek.com@relay.cs.net +1 (503) 245-2202
